Di dalam zaman dunia maya yang terus terus bermutasi, kebutuhan akan software web yang cepat serta responsif kian meningkat. Dalam upaya mengatasi tantangan ini, belajar kerangka kerja antarmuka depan Next.js dapat menjadi solusi yang untuk para pengembang. NextJS memberikan berbagai fitur unggulan seperti peralihan halaman yang cepat, peningkatan kinerja, dan dukungan untuk pengembangan aplikasi yang lebih efektif. Dengan artikel ini kita ingin mengajak Anda agar mengetahui lebih dalam cara belajar kerangka kerja antarmuka depan Next.js dapat mentransformasi proyek menjadi menjadi lebih inovatif dan bersaing.

Sebagai salah satu kerangka kerja paling diminati di antara pengembang, Next.js menyuguhkan sejumlah kemudahan dan keluwesan dalam tahapan pengembangan. Selain itu, dengan menggunakan inovasi mutakhir dari dunia React.js, menguasai framework frontend Next.js tidak hanya menambah kemampuan teknis Anda, tetapi juga memberikan banyak kesempatan baru di industri teknologi saat ini. Mari bergabung bersama kami untuk menelusuri kemampuan menarik dan manfaat belajar kerangka kerja frontend Next.js, serta bagaimana hal ini dapat mengubah proyek web anda dengan drastis.

Apa alasan Next.js sebagai menjadi opsi terbaik untuk pengembangan antarmuka depan?

Framework Next.js telah bertransformasi menjadi favorit untuk pengembangan frontend dengan kemampuan luar biasanya dalam membangun website modern. Saat Anda pertama menjelajahi kerangka kerja frontend Next.js, Anda akan menemukan beragam fitur keren termasuk rendering awal, generasi situs statis, dan rendering sisi server. Semua fitur ini memungkinkan pengembang untuk membangun program yang tangguh, menjadikannya sebagai pilihan yang sangat wow untuk proyek besar atau mini. Bertambahnya korporasi yang beralih ke Next.js, menyebabkannya menjadi salah satu framework yang populer dalam komunitas pengembang.

Mempelajari kerangka kerja frontend Next.js tidak hanya soal menguasai sintaks dan strukturasi, tetapi juga memahami konsep fundamental development web. Dengan memanfaatkan Next.js, kamu dapat meningkatkan user experience user dengan praktis, berkat hot reloading dan dukungan untuk penjelajahan yang dinamis. Ketika Anda mengerti Next.js, Anda akan mendapatkan tools yang tangguh untuk merancang antarmuka pengguna yang interaktif dan atraktif, meningkatkan keterampilan kamu dalam ranah pengembangan frontend.

Keuntungan lain dari mempelajari framework frontend Next.js adalah lingkungan yang mendukung dan komunitas yang dinamis. Forum forum, petunjuk, dan penjelasan yang tersedia akan amat membantu Anda dalam perjalanan mempelajari Next.js. Dengan kian populernya teknologi ini, banyak perusahaan yang mencari pengembang yang mahiran dalam Next.js, memberi Anda kesempatan lebih besar di pasar kerja. Oleh karena itu, tidak ada waktu yang lebih baik untuk mulai pembelajaran framework frontend Next.js dan menyiapkan diri untuk ujian di masa depan.

Fitur Kunci Next.js Framework yang Akan Meningkatkan Kualitas Proyek

Fitur kunci dari Next.js sangat krusial untuk mengembangkan proyek Anda. Dengan mendalami kerangka kerja frontend Next.js, Anda akan menemukan bahwa kapasitas untuk melakukan server-side rendering (SSR) dan static site generation (SSG) bisa meningkatkan waktu muatan halaman dan mengoptimalkan SEO proyek Anda. Ini adalah salah satu alasan mengapa Next.js merupakan pilihan utama bagi banyak developer yang ingin mengoptimalkan website mereka. Dengan memanfaatkan fitur ini, Anda bisa menawarkan kualitas yang lebih responsif kepada pengguna, yang pada pada akhirnya berpengaruh positif pada engagement dan retensi pengguna.

Waktu Anda menyelami framework frontend Next.js, Anda akan menemukan kemampuan pengaturan yang lebih baik melalui API. Kemampuan ini memberikan kesempatan Anda untuk mengatur dan mengatur data dengan lebih efisien, yang membantu pengembang dalam menciptakan komunikasi antara frontend dan backend. Dengan optimasi data yang lebih baik, proyek Anda tidak hanya akan berjalan lebih halus tetapi juga lebih mudah untuk ditingkatkan dan dirawat di kemudian. Hal ini membuat Next.js sebagai pilihan yang bijak bagi siapa saja yang serius dalam membangun aplikasi web.

Integrasi Next.js dengan alat serta teknolog populer contohnya GraphQL TypeScript, dan CSS-in-JS adalah fitur tambahan yang membuat mempelajari framework frontend Next.js jadi amat menarik. Fitur ini memungkinkan memberikan peluang developer dalam memanfaatkan berbagai alat kontemporer yang dapat meningkatkan produktivitas serta mutu kode program. Dengan menggunakan gabungan fitur ini, kita dapat menghasilkan proyek-proyek yang tak hanya menarik dari segi visual tetapi juga sangat fungsional. Oleh karena itu, jika kamu mencari jalan agar meningkatkan keterampilan sekali meningkatkan proyek Anda, menguasai Next.js merupakan pilihan yang benar.

Cara Mudah Mula dengan Next.js untuk Awalnya

Poin pertama dalam mempelajari framework frontend Next.js adalah memahami fundamental dari framework ini. Next.js merupakan framework React yang mengizinkan developer untuk merancang aplikasi web dengan kinerja tinggi, serta menyediakan eksperien yang lebih optimal untuk pengguna. Dengan mempelajari kerangka kerja frontend Next.js, orang baru dapat dengan cepat menciptakan aplikasi yang SEO-friendly dan dengan waktu muat yang efisien. Menguasai dasar-dasar Next.js bakal membantu pengembang pemula dalam membangun aplikasi yang lebih kompleks di kemudian hari.

Sesudah memahami fundamentals Next.js, langkah berikutnya adalah menginstal dan mengatur project awal. Pengguna baru dapat memanfaatkan npm atau yarn untuk menginstall Next.js dan mendirikan proyek baru hanya beberapa komando mudah. Selama tahapan ini, krusial untuk terus belajar tentang susunan direktori dalam Next.js, yang mencakup folder pages dan components, serta cara cara kerja routing dalam aplikasi. Dengan belajar framework frontend Next.js, pengguna baru akan mengalami bahwa pengaturan proyek menjadi cukup gampang dan intuitif.

Sesudah pekerjaan siap, pemula bisa mulai berlatih dengan kemungkinan yang ditawarkan dari Next.js. Mulailah dengan merancang bagian dasar dan menambahkan halaman-halaman dengn memanfaatkan rute. Di samping itu, penjelajahan lebih lanjut mengenai Static Site Generation (SSG) dan Server-Side Rendering (SSR) bakal sangat bermanfaat. Belajar kerangka kerja frontend Next.js bukan hanya seputar ilmu teori, melainkan serta pengalaman langsung dalam hal menciptakan aplikasi yg fun dan interaktif.